The following information gives the marks scored by the students of a class in an examination. Find the mode of the data. `{:("Marks",1-20,21-40,41-60,61-80,81-100),("Number of Students",3,18,23,37,19):}`

Here, the given classes are not continuous. Hence, we first rewrite it as shown below:
`{:("Marks","Adjusted Marks","Number of Students"),(1-20," "0.5-20.5," "3),(21-40," "20.5-40.5," "18),(41-60," "40.5-60.5," "23(f_(i))),(61-80," "60.5-80.5," "37(f)),(81-100," "80.5-100.5," "19(f_(2))):}`
From the above table it can be observed that the maximum frequency occurs in the class interval 61-80.
`therefore f = 37, f_(1) = 23, f_(2) = 19, L_(1) = 60.5, C = 20`.
`" "therefore "Mode" = L_(1) + ((f-f_(1))C)/((f-f_(1)) + (f-f_(2)))`
`" " = 60.5 + ((37-23)20)/(14+18) = 60.5 + 8.75 = 69.25`.
